Mental health treatment is an essential component of the treatment of substance abuse disorders, due to the fact that a significantly large number of individuals with an addiction disorder struggle with a co-occurring mental health problem. In most cases, mental health treatment starts with the initial diagnosis of the person's disorder, particularly when addiction is present. In many cases, the client doesn't initially even know they have an anxiety disorder or are suffering with depression until it is discovered in a mental health physician's office or treatment facility. Once diagnosed, treatment steps can be put forth to help the person resolve issues and become more stable, and this may incorporate the use of specific counseling, therapies, and possibly medication or cessation of medication. In many cases however, individuals struggling with a dual diagnosis are attempting to self-medicate with drugs and alcohol or possibly misusing their medications. In these instances, professional staff and medical practitioners can evaluate medication histories and recommend steps which can be taken to remove the need for medication. Clients can be harmlessly weaned off of medications which may be doing more harm than good, or those which they tend to abuse.
